ABSTRACT:
An externally-developed airbag device is provided in which side bag members are expanded along pillars in expanding the airbag and in which even after the airbag has been fully expanded, the frontal view at the front side of the airbag from a driver seat is secured. The airbag can include a lower bag member that is expandable in the width direction (in the left-right direction) of a vehicle along a cowl top portion of the vehicle, left and right side bag members being expandable to be protruded in the upward direction along left and right pillars of the vehicle from both of the left and right ends of the lower bag member, and connecting members provided in an angle portion, in one form, between the respective side bag members and the lower bag member for connecting the side bag members and the lower bag member.
